In the context of VNAV, what is a "profile descent"?

Explanation:
A "profile descent" in the context of VNAV refers to a descent path that provides a gradual reduction in altitude over a specific distance. This technique is especially beneficial for optimizing fuel efficiency and ensuring a smooth transition for the aircraft as it approaches its destination. By maintaining a controlled descent, pilots can manage airspeed and altitude more effectively, which is crucial for ensuring safety and compliance with air traffic control directives. This approach contrasts with a steep descent, which is not characteristic of a profile descent as it would involve a more abrupt change in altitude over a shorter distance. Additionally, a constant altitude flight segment does not represent a descent at all; it simply describes maintaining the same altitude. A level flight segment, too, focuses on maintaining specific altitude and speed parameters without any descent, which diverges from the concept of reducing altitude gradually. The essence of a profile descent lies in its ability to balance the need for altitude reduction with efficiency and safety during the landing approach.
